Response From Kelli Scott
KY OVR (at this time) only purchases BTE or full-shell ITE’s which are FM/ ALD ready or compatible. I know that this is a lengthy Service Fee and it is ever-evolving. Basically, we have agreements with the 7 major HA manufacturers as to the allowable rate (i.e. state Medicaid rates). We only apply our cost-sharing rules to the amount above $1,000 and only pay up to $800 per aid plus dispensing fee. The attached SFM explains the details. Don’t hesitate to contact me for more information.
Even with all these caveats most audiologists are still happy to serve our consumers.

Response From Warren Granfor
Hi Richard,
NDVR pays the invoice price for the hearing aid. A long time ago, over 20 years ago, we paid the Medicaid rate for the dispensing/fitting fee, which was abysmal. We then came up with our own fitting fee which is currently at $911 per aid for both in-ear and behind the ear. That amount should increase July 1. Attached is our current payment schedule. It talks about Level 1 and Level 2 hearing aids. I should remove the Level 1 hearing aid verbage since it’s been years since I’ve seen one of those. Let me know if you have any questions.

Response From Terry Morrell
In Maine the Bureau of Rehabilitation Services (BRS) procures hearing aids for eligible clients of the Vocational Rehabilitation Program through a multi-state cooperative agreement administered by the State of Minnesota Cooperative Purchasing Venture (MNCPV). Contracts with a number of hearing aid manufacturers offer significant discounts from list price on a variety of types and models of hearing aids. Response From Kathleen Enders
In WI we will pay the invoice cost for the hearing aid plus 15% and pay the Medicaid rate for the dispensing fee. We just updated our hearing aid guidance for staff.
